Brief Biography of Guide, Yuichi Hashimoto

1962:                      Born in Tokyo

1986:                      Completed master's course in civil engineering (belonged to the Wandervogel club while in college, enjoying mountains such as Daisetsuzan in Hokkaido in the north and Mt. Miyanoura in Yakushima in the south)

1986-1989:          Lecturer at Jomo Kenyatta University of Agriculture and Technology in Kenya as a Japan Overseas Cooperation Volunteer (climbed Mt. Kenya and Mt. Kilimanjaro)

1989-Present:    Engaged in domestic and overseas water supply and sewerage projects as a construction consultant

2019:                      Published a paper on water purification methods in the International Water Association (IWA) (see below)

2019-Present:      Started activities as a mountaineering guide

Qualifications:     Japan Mountain Guides Association Certified Guide Climbing Guide Stage II (Not available for guides on rocky mountains such as Mt. Tsurugi in Northern Alps)
